Is white rice the king of junk food? The doctor's reply is brilliant

Netizen question: I love rice so much that I can eat a big bowl of rice with a few chili peppers.

A while ago I saw a saying that "white rice is the king of junk food". Is this statement reliable? Also, is it necessary to replace white rice with whole grains?

This statement is simply nonsense!

In fact, we have debunked this rumor before. It seems that “rumors are permanent, but readers come and go”!

Let’s take a look at the structure of rice first!

The edible parts of a whole grain include the bran, endosperm, and germ.

However, such grains are neither white and beautiful, nor do they taste delicate.

Therefore, in order to cater to the public and facilitate grain storage, people ground the rough grains layer by layer into crystal clear, white rice, which is the refined white rice we usually eat.

It is true that refined rice loses some nutrients, such as B vitamins, dietary fiber, vitamin E, etc.

But at the same time, it also retains a large amount of starch, some protein, and a small amount of vitamins and minerals.

In general, rice is by no means junk food, but a source of energy for us.

For example, white rice is rich in starch, which is broken down into glucose by the digestive tract, and glucose is the only energy substance that our brain can use.

If there is a lack of glucose, the brain will lack power, causing irritability, dizziness and even memory loss.

Therefore, we cannot simply reject refined rice, nor can we eat it in excess.

Most people, especially diabetic patients, should choose refined rice while consuming a moderate amount of coarse grains, such as brown rice, black rice, millet, oats, etc. This has a positive effect on controlling blood sugar, weight, and blood lipids.

It is generally recommended to use a ratio of 2/3 white rice + 1/3 coarse grains for cooking rice and porridge.

As for "replacing all white rice with whole grains", this is absolutely not advisable.

If we do this, we will consume too much dietary fiber, which will cause constipation, bloating, indigestion and other phenomena.

In addition, excessive intake of dietary fiber and phytic acid will inhibit the absorption of nutrients such as calcium, iron, and zinc, which is not worth the cost for us.
